Agree specifications for new properties with buyersReal unit · Pearson Education Ltd

What you'll be able to do

  • Understand legal and organisational procedures for agreeing specifications for new properties with prospective buyers
  • Understand how to agree specifications for new properties with prospective buyers
  • Agree specifications for new properties with prospective buyers
  • Progress specifications for new properties with prospective buyers

Develop marketing materials for the promotion of residential property servicesReal unit · Pearson Education Ltd
You'll learn to create marketing materials promoting residential property services. The unit covers organisational procedures, the influence of marketing materials on target audiences, adherence to brand guidelines, and the preparation and arrangement of marketing materials for production.

What you'll be able to do

  • Understand organisational procedures for developing marketing materials for the promotion of residential property services
  • Understand how marketing materials can influence the key audience
  • Understand how to prepare marketing materials for residential properties for sale
  • Understand how to arrange for the production of final marketing materials for residential property for sale
  • Develop recommendations for marketing materials
  • Prepare agreed materials for production

Obtain instructions and agree marketing activities for propertiesReal unit · Pearson Education Ltd
This unit equips learners with knowledge of legal and regulatory requirements for obtaining instructions to market properties. You'll understand the importance of client identity verification and be able to agree marketing plans and activities with clients, considering budgetary and promotional factors.

What you'll be able to do

  • Obtain instructions for marketing properties
  • Agree planned marketing activities for properties
  • Obtain instructions for marketing properties
  • Agree marketing plans for properties

Progress sales of residential propertyReal unit · Pearson Education Ltd
You'll gain a comprehensive understanding of progressing residential property sales, including organisational procedures, involved parties, and necessary documentation. They will develop skills to plan, implement, and monitor sales progress while adhering to legal and regulatory requirements.

What you'll be able to do

  • Understand organisational procedures for progressing the sale of residential property
  • Know which parties are involved with progressing sales of residential property
  • Know which documentation is involved with progressing sales of residential property
  • Understand how to progress sales of residential property
  • Plan and implement the sales of property
  • Monitor the progress of sales to their conclusion

Understanding legislation, guidelines, codes of practice and statutory information in residential salesReal unit · Pearson Education Ltd
This unit provides learners with knowledge of legislation, guidelines, codes of practice, and statutory information in residential sales. You'll explore the regulatory framework and its impact on estate agency practices.

What you'll be able to do

  • Understand the key legislation, guidelines, and codes of practice relevant to residential sales.
  • Understand the implications of these regulations for estate agents and their clients.
  • Understand the importance of adhering to legal and ethical standards in residential sales.
  • Understand the statutory information that must be provided to potential buyers in residential sales.
  • Understand the requirements for property information questionnaires and other legal documents.
  • Understand the consequences of failing to comply with statutory requirements.
